Milwaukee Childhood Obesity Prevention Project (MCOPP)
Working together for healthy eating and active living




The Milwaukee Childhood Obesity Prevention Project (MCOPP) is an inclusive coalition with the goal of reducing childhood obesity in Milwaukee through environmental and policy changes that promote healthy eating and active living.


Our members include leaders and staff from the eight member agencies of the United Neighborhood Centers of Milwaukee (UNCOM), youth-serving organizations, community residents, and experts in the fields of nutrition, exercise science, physical education, public health, medicine, and urban planning.
